What Sets Windows 11 Apart From Previous Versions
Windows 11 is the recent innovation by Microsoft in operating systems, with an intuitive and visually appealing design. It rolls out a center-focused Start Menu with a neat taskbar, and soft edges to provide a premium and fluid appearance. Computing efficiency has been raised with faster performance. Reducing lag during heavy multitasking sessions.

Microsoft Teams Integration
Windows 11 integrates Microsoft Teams, enabling seamless communication with family, friends, and colleagues directly from your desktop.
-
Windows Subsystem for Linux 2 (WSL2)
Windows 11 includes WSL2, allowing developers to run a complete Linux kernel on their system, enhancing cross-platform development.
-
Better Window Resizing
Windows 11 enhances window resizing, making it easier to manage multiple windows and fit them perfectly for better multitasking.
-
Personalized Taskbar Widgets
The taskbar in Windows 11 can be customized with widgets, offering quick access to useful information like weather, news, and calendar updates.

Virtual Desktop Support: Simplifying Multitasking with Virtual Desktop Capabilities
Virtual Desktop Support is part of the Windows 10 and Windows 11 operating systems. It allows you to run different applications across separate desktops, streamlining your workflow. Virtual Desktop Support helps you keep your tasks in order by quickly switching between desktops. It is a feature supported in both Windows 10 and Windows 11 for home and business use.
